Truth quotes


The pure and simple truth is rarely pure and never simple.

   Oscar Wilde quotes

  

Truth is more of a stranger than fiction.

   Mark Twain quotes

  

Never tell the truth to those unworthy of it....

   Mark Twain quotes

  

Fiction is obliged to stick to possibilities. Truth isn't.

   Mark Twain quotes

  

In the attitude of silence the soul finds the path in an clearer light, and what is elusive and deceptive resolves itself into crystal clearness. Our life is a long and arduous quest after Truth.

   Mahatma Gandhi quotes

  

Cynicism is an unpleasant way of saying the truth.

   Lillian Hellman quotes

  

Truth, like gold, is to be obtained not by its growth, but by washing away from it all that is not gold.

   Leo Nikolaevich Tolstoy quotes

  

Many speak the truth when they say that they despise riches, but they mean the riches possessed by others.

   Charles Caleb Colton quotes

  

Truth can never be told so as to be understood, and not be believed.

   William Blake quotes

  

In art, truth and reality begin when one no longer understands what one is doing or what one knows, and when there remains an energy that is all the stronger for being constrained, controlled and compressed.

   Henri Matisse quotes
